SAN JOSE, CA — Police offered a $10,000 reward for information leading to the arrest of a man who fatally shot another man in a dispute over a parking space in 2021.

The slaying happened around 7:46 p.m. June 4, 2021, in the area of 4100 The Woods Drive, an apartment complex in San Jose, according to the San Jose Police Department. Officers found a man who had been shot and killed in front of his family.

Detectives identified Uatesoni Joseph Paasi as the suspect and issued an arrest warrant for homicide. He is believed to be in the area of Baja, Mexico, and should be considered armed and dangerous, police said.

The killing was the city's 19th homicide of 2021.

Anyone with information on the whereabouts of Paasi was asked to contact Detective Sgt. Barragan at 4106@sanjoseca.gov or Detective Harrington 4365@sanjoseca.gov or 408-277-5283.

Information leading to Paasi's arrest and extradition is eligible for a $10,000 reward from the department.
